Job Summary

Join a growing AECOM team focused on AMP8 water industry transformation, working across England & Wales with hybrid options. This expression of interest connects you with opportunities spanning civil, structural, mechanical & electrical engineering, design management, hydraulic and flood modeling, and project management. Collaborate across disciplines across the full project lifecycle—from feasibility and design through delivery and asset management—on major UK water frameworks with real community impact.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Work on major UK water frameworks and programmes, supporting the delivery of AMP8 transformation.
  • •Collaborate across disciplines across the full project lifecycle, from feasibility and design to delivery and asset management.
  • •Apply expertise in relevant engineering areas (e.g., design management, lead design engineering, hydraulic & network modelling, or flood & coastal modelling).
  • •Contribute to projects that improve communities and protect the environment, including drainage and wastewater management initiatives.
  • •Participate in onboarding as a condition of employment, including an in-person Day 1 onboarding at an AECOM office location.

Key Requirements

  • •Knowledge and experience of the water sector.
  • •A degree or equivalent in a related engineering subject (e.g., civil, electrical, mechanical).
  • •Relevant experience in a similar role for a water company, consultancy, or contractors.
  • •Expertise in areas such as civil engineering, structural engineering, or mechanical & electrical engineering.
  • •Experience in hydraulic & network modelling or flood & coastal modelling is a plus.

Company Brief

AECOM
AECOM is a global infrastructure firm providing design, consulting, construction, and management services across transportation, buildings, water, environment, and energy sectors, delivering large-scale projects for public- and private-sector clients worldwide.
